Question

which is the best way to complete the text?

taking a good photograph of the moon at night can be ________ you may have better luck getting a clear image if you attach your camera to a tripod and choose a low iso setting, which decreases your cameras sensitivity to light.

challenging, but,

challenging; however,

challenging, or

Explanation:

Analyze the sentence structure

The text consists of two independent clauses:

  1. "Taking a good photograph of the moon at night can be [blank]"
  2. "you may have better luck getting a clear image if you attach your camera to a tripod and choose a low ISO setting..."

Both clauses can stand alone as complete sentences.

Evaluate the punctuation options

To connect two independent clauses, we must use proper punctuation to avoid a run-on sentence:

  • "challenging, but," is incorrect because "but" is a coordinating conjunction. If used to connect two independent clauses, the comma should precede "but" (e.g., ", but"), not follow it.
  • "challenging, or" is incorrect because "or" does not fit the contrastive relationship between the two clauses, and it would create a comma splice if used without proper structure.
  • "challenging; however," is correct. A semicolon is used to link two independent clauses, and the conjunctive adverb "however" is followed by a comma to show contrast.
